Web25 sep. 2024 · One of the key issues that this hymn accents is the idea of the pre-existence of Jesus. While we see that idea very clearly in the Gospel of John, let us not forget that this hymn was much earlier. If we accept that the letter to the Philippians was written around 56-60AD, this hymn, and the theology it contained, was sung even before that. WebFor thirty years Ralph P. Web2 sep. 2011 · Philippians 2:6-8 The “hymn” form proper begins with these verses that constitute its first half. The focus is upon the “humiliation” of Christ, not inflicted but freely taken on. “Form” occurs three times in these verses, although two Greek words are used.
